For Immediate Release: Thursday, March 6, 2014
Detectives from the Montgomery County Police - Family Crimes Division are asking for the public's assistance in locating a juvenile missing from Silver Spring.
Martin Curtis Reed, age 15, of Carona Court in Silver Spring was last seen earlier today. He left his residence after a family argument.
Reed is described as a white male, 5'9" inches tall, and weighing approximately 210 pounds. He has blue eyes and short blonde/brown hair. Reed was last seen wearing blue sweatpants, a black sweatshirt, and a camouflage vest. He was also carrying a backpack and a second black bag similar in style to a pool cue bag. He is walking with one crutch due to a broken left leg that is in a cast.
Police and family are concerned for Reed's physical and mental well-being.
Anyone with information regarding Reed's whereabouts is asked to contact the Montgomery County Police non-emergency number, 301-279-8000. Callers may remain anonymous.
